I finally got all of the little issues worked out on the motor, it is a Merc 120. It was doing well out of the hole. The only thing that really needed to be taken care of next was the prop. It has seen better days. <br /><br />My buddy and I went out this morning to do a little wakeboarding the boat is running well. we decided to take off down the river for a bit and as we were doing about 35mph, the boat just lost all power. The rpms went through the roof, but the boat didn't go anywhere. We had to drive the boat back to the ramp whiche was about 3 miles going about 4mph. I could push the throttle down all the way and we wouldn't go anywhere. Like we were just spinning out, but we were on water so that wasn't possible.<br /><br />I am guessing there is something wrong in my lower unit, but has anyone ever had this happen to them? I am hoping it is something that I can fix myself. Any advise is always appreciated.
